site stats

Calculator hamming code

WebCalculating the Hamming Code The key to the Hamming Code is the use of extra parity bits to allow the identification of a single error. Create the code word as follows: Mark all … WebJun 6, 2024 · The Binary Hamming code Using the idea of creating parity bits with the XOR operator, we can create what is called the Hamming [7, 4] -code. We will combine multiple bits to create each of the parity bits for this code. This code will take in a four-bit input and encode it into a seven-bit codeword.

(7,4) Hamming Code

Webhamming code Natural Language Math Input Use Math Input Mode to directly enter textbook math notation. Try it Extended Keyboard Examples WebDec 15, 2024 · This video contains the description about the example problem on 9-bit hamming code. #Hammingcode #Exampleproblemonhammingcode #Hamming We reimagined … change start menu background image windows 10 https://sexycrushes.com

Two dimensional parity check - Computer Science Stack Exchange

WebStep 1: Enter the input data to be encoded Bin Hex Use extra parity bit Step 2 [optional]: Click the "View/Modify Syndromes" button to view or modify the syndromes Step 3: Click … WebHamming codes are a series of codes / algorithms used to automatically correct binary messages if a corrupted / erroneous bit (0 or 1) is transmitted. The correction is done … WebIn mathematicalterms, Hamming codes are a class of binary linear code. For each integer r≥ 2there is a code-word with block lengthn= 2r− 1and message lengthk= 2r− r− 1. change start menu color windows

Converting 8 bits to a scaled 12 bits equivalent - Stack Overflow

Category:Hamming Code : Parity Generation, Error Detection

Tags:Calculator hamming code

Calculator hamming code

How to Calculate Hamming Distance of CRC code - Stack Overflow

WebFeb 2, 2024 · We will give you a hint on how to calculate the Hamming distance in a binary and a decimal message. Take two binarymessages with equal length, and write them … WebIn coding theory, Hamming (7,4) is a linear error-correcting code that encodes four bits of data into seven bits by adding three parity bits. It is a member of a larger family of Hamming codes, but the term Hamming code often refers to this specific code that Richard W. Hamming introduced in 1950.

Calculator hamming code

Did you know?

WebDec 27, 2024 · A (7, 4) Hamming code may define parity bits p1, p2, and p3as p1= d2+ d3+ d4 p2= d1+ d3+ d4 p3= d1+ d2+ d4 There's a fourth equation for a parity bit that may be used in Hamming codes: p4= d1+ d2+ d3 Valid Hamming codes may use any three of the above four parity bit definitions. Valid Hamming codes may also place the parity bits in any WebThe Hamming distance defines the number of bits that need to change in a binary value in order to produce another value. In this example we can enter a number of binary values: Hamming distance of 01,11,10 gives a Hamming distance of 1. Calc. Hamming distance of 00000, 01101, 10110, 11011 gives a Hamming distance of 3. Calc.

WebThe numbers behind the 'bars/underscores' are the parity-check bits, it means that in each column/row is even count of number 1. So the minimum distance equals to 2. That means according to the rule t < d, that this code can detect only a t-bit error, which means 1 ( but that's not true, because it can detect 3 bit erros). WebThe standard way of finding out the parity matrix G k, n for a Hamming code is constructing first the check parity matrix H n − k, n in systematic form. For this, we recall that a Hamming code has d = 3 (minimum distance). Hence the columns of H have the property that we can find a set of 3 linearly dependent columns, but not 2 columns or less.

WebMar 28, 2024 · Hamming (7, 4) code: It is a linear error-correcting code that encodes four bits of data into seven bits, by adding three parity bits. Example: It is used in the Bell-Telephone laboratory, error-prone punch caret reader to detect the error and correct them. Hamming code: P 1 = d 1 ⊕ d 2 ⊕ d 4 P 2 = d 1 ⊕ d 4 ⊕ d 3 P 3 = d 2 ⊕ d 4 ⊕ d 3 … WebIn coding theory, Hamming (7,4) is a linear error-correcting code that encodes four bits of data into seven bits by adding three parity bits. It is a member of a larger family of …

WebHamming codes. For any r, construct a binary r 2r 1 matrix H such that each nonzero binary r-tuple occurs exactly once as a column of H. Any code with such a check matrix H is a binary Hamming code of redundancy binary Hamming code r, denoted Ham r(2). Thus the [7;4] code is a Hamming code Ham 3(2). Each

WebHamming Codes are linear block codes designed to detect and correct errors introduced in message bits transmitted from an end to another through a communication channel. … hardy blurry coverWebYour browser must be able to display frames to use this simulator. BLANK hardy blockWebMar 25, 2024 · Hamming code is a set of error-correction codes that can be used to detect and correct the errors that can occur when the data is moved or stored from the sender to the receiver. It is a technique … hardy bmo space